An Unbiased View of best security software development life cycle methodology
Architects may use an architecture framework such as TOGAF to compose an application from existing factors, endorsing reuse and standardization.
Veracode causes it to be feasible to combine automatic security screening into the SDLC system. Here is how you can deal with the process successfully:
*Gartner will not endorse any seller, service or product depicted in its research publications, and isn't going to advise technological innovation customers to pick out only These suppliers with the highest rankings or other designation. Gartner investigate publications include the viewpoints of Gartner's analysis Corporation and shouldn't be construed as statements of actuality.
There are actually quite a few Advantages for deploying a procedure development life cycle which include the ability to pre-system and evaluate structured phases and aims.
These automatic equipment also can help with scanning and testing applications during operate-time (dynamic) so that you can debug & exam the code's implementation. Protected code overview (static) and application penetration exams (dynamic) are two methodologies that should also be used in the full software DLC & built-in into recent workflows to be able to make certain that software is constructed with security in mind from starting to conclusion.
We're sorry, the browser you are using is limiting the functionality of the Web-site. To find the best working experience, we endorse that you turn to an up-to-date completely supported Net browser. If you're feeling that you have obtained click here this message in error, be sure to Call us. 
It click here does not support feedback through the entire procedure, resulting in check here the implementation of needs which could have changed throughout the development effort. This weak point in Waterfall led for the development of extra adaptable methodologies, such as Agile.
In the aptitude Maturity Design for Software, the objective of “software assurance†is referred to as delivering acceptable visibility into the method being used through the software assignments and to the items getting developed [Paulk 93].
you consent to our usage of cookies. To determine more about how we use cookies, please see our Cookie Plan.
Storing knowledge and information securely helps prevent unauthorized men and women or parties from accessing it in addition to averts intentional or accidental destruction of the knowledge. When developing software, it is crucial to take into account where the data accessed by the appliance are going to be prepared, study, monitored, or shared.
Together with the vast number of threats that continually tension firms and governments, it's important in order that the software programs these corporations employ are completely safe. Secure development is often a apply in order that the code and processes that go into acquiring programs are as protected as you can.
Cellular SecurityRead about the newest information and tendencies inside the Cellular AppSec arena, in which we Stick to the route of cellular cybercrime, in which the condition of cellular security is right now, and in which we’re headed tomorrow.
Developers use proven Structure Styles to unravel algorithmic challenges in a very reliable way. This period may additionally incorporate some quick prototyping, also called a spike, to check options to find the best fit. The output of this section incorporates:
We are developing an internet healthcare facility administration process and it is required promptly, what type of SDLC design click here must be Utilized in our documentation?